Weed in Bali : Dangers and Outcomes
While the Island of Gods is known for its breathtaking beauty and peaceful atmosphere, consumption of cannabis carries serious risks and possible consequences. It’s important to understand that marijuana remains prohibited in Indonesia, and the region operates under Indonesian law. Penalties can be harsh , including long incarceration and large monetary penalties . Even small offenses , such as keeping a limited amount, can lead to confinement. In addition, Balinese culture generally disapproves of drug use . Seeking medicinal herbal remedies is also illegal without proper medical authorization .
